Word "INCONVENIENT" Definitions:


Part of Speech:
Adjective
Definition:
not conveniently timed
Examples:
an early departure is inconvenient for us

Part of Speech:
Adjective
Definition:
not suited to your comfort, purpose or needs
Examples:
it is inconvenient not to have a telephone in the kitchen
the back hall is an inconvenient place for the telephone
